Bijoux

Jack Dawson's drawing of Madame Bijoux

Madame Bijoux was an elderly woman whom Jack Dawson had met in Paris. She claimed she came each night in the bar wearing all the jewelry she owned while "waiting for her long lost love". He had made a portrait of her and kept it in his sketchbook. Her character was never actually seen in the film. She was merely a drawing that Jack showed Rose DeWitt Bukater.

Trivia[]

According to IMDB, the drawing is based on a 1933 photograph called "Bijou" taken by famous photographer Brassaï.
